Transaction 9775856064235862f48c4607f31d1f8b707d76d28d8b71b5754174323624a7ce

2 Input
1 Outputs
  • 9775856064235862f48c4607f31d1f8b707d76d28d8b71b5754174323624a7ce:0
  • value  513160
    address  14fdxm8HFX3bRkNqas1BTYV5QXAQ5F9qwo